You Will :
The Supervisor Onsite Services reports to the Manager Onsite Services and will lead a team and oversee all Onsite services (KeepStock - our customer managed inventory solution) within a specific geography and customers. Ensure execution of the onsite services activities through demonstrated leadership in the areas of talent excellence, customer service, sales growth, and cost to serve.
KeepStock Management / Leadership :
Coach a team of 4-9 Onsite Representative and Specialists to maintain customer accounts within in a geography or customer and stock and organize products on time using essential tools and metrics.Select, coach, and retain a diverse team.Set the example and coach leaders in their understanding and commitment to live the Grainger values while creating positive team member engagement.Financial Performance / Resource Management :
Manage KeepStock projects in the service geography focused on improving productivity and profitability of the KeepStock offering.Ensure proper solutions and resources are being offered / deployed to customers.Partnerships to Influence Growth :
Partner with the sales team, providing expertise in Keepstock offer to help sales team to exceed incremental sales growth expectations to meet Return on investment for KeepStock sites.Maintain customer relationships and partner with the sales & branch teams to identify and address service opportunities.Be a strong KeepStock advocate by building an internal network with local Customer Service, Sales, Supply Chain and Consulting collaborators.You Have :
